What Should You Look for When Choosing the Best Smart AV Receiver?

When choosing the best smart AV receiver, consider the following key features:

  • Audio and Video Quality: Look for receivers that support high-definition formats like 4K and HDR for video, and advanced audio codecs like Dolby Atmos and DTS:X for immersive sound. The quality of DACs (Digital-to-Analog Converters) also plays a crucial role in delivering clear and detailed audio output.
  • Connectivity Options: Ensure the receiver has ample HDMI inputs, especially with HDMI 2.1 compatibility for next-gen gaming consoles and other devices. Additionally, check for support for wireless connections, including Wi-Fi and Bluetooth, to stream music from various devices.
  • Smart Features and Compatibility: The best smart AV receivers should integrate seamlessly with smart home ecosystems, supporting voice control through platforms like Amazon Alexa, Google Assistant, or Apple HomeKit. Look for built-in streaming services and compatibility with apps like Spotify, Tidal, or others for easy access to your music library.
  • Multi-Room Audio Support: Consider receivers that offer multi-room capabilities, allowing you to enjoy audio in different areas of your home. Technologies such as Sonos, DTS Play-Fi, or similar can enhance your listening experience by streaming audio to various speakers or zones simultaneously.
  • User Interface and Setup: A user-friendly interface and easy setup process are essential for a hassle-free experience. Look for receivers that come with on-screen setup guides, mobile apps for configuration, and automatic calibration features to optimize sound based on your room’s acoustics.
  • Power and Performance: Check the power output of the receiver to ensure it can drive your speakers effectively without distortion. Look for receivers with sufficient wattage per channel, as well as features like dynamic power control to handle peaks in audio without compromising quality.
  • Brand Reputation and Support: Choose from reputable brands known for quality and customer service. Research reviews and ratings to gauge reliability and long-term performance, as well as warranty options that can provide peace of mind.

How Do Smart AV Receivers Differ from Traditional AV Receivers?

Smart AV receivers offer advanced features that enhance connectivity and usability compared to traditional AV receivers.

  • Network Connectivity: Smart AV receivers typically include Wi-Fi and Ethernet ports, allowing for seamless streaming from various online services like Spotify, Tidal, and more. This contrasts with traditional receivers, which often lack internet capabilities, limiting audio and video sources to physical media and local devices.
  • Multi-Room Audio: Many smart AV receivers support multi-room audio configurations, enabling users to play different music in different rooms or synchronize audio throughout the home. Traditional receivers usually do not support this feature or require additional equipment to achieve similar functionality.
  • Voice Control Integration: Smart AV receivers often come equipped with compatibility for voice assistants such as Amazon Alexa, Google Assistant, or Apple Siri, allowing for hands-free control of playback and settings. Traditional receivers typically require manual operation or remote control, lacking this convenient feature.
  • Streaming and App Control: These devices often have dedicated apps that allow users to control settings and streaming services directly from their smartphones or tablets, providing greater ease of use. In contrast, traditional receivers usually rely on physical remotes and lack sophisticated app interfaces, making them less user-friendly.
  • Firmware Updates and Feature Enhancements: Smart AV receivers can receive firmware updates over the internet, enabling users to access new features, improvements, and security patches. Traditional receivers usually do not offer this capability, resulting in potential obsolescence as technology advances.

What Common Problems Can Arise with Smart AV Receivers?

Common problems that can arise with smart AV receivers include:

  • Connectivity Issues: Smart AV receivers often depend on a stable Wi-Fi connection for streaming services and updates. If the Wi-Fi signal is weak or inconsistent, it can lead to interruptions in streaming, difficulties in connecting to devices, or even the inability to use smart features.
  • Software Bugs and Glitches: As with any smart device, AV receivers may encounter software bugs that can affect performance. These issues can manifest as crashes, slow responses, or the failure of certain features, necessitating firmware updates or factory resets to resolve.
  • Compatibility Problems: Smart AV receivers need to work seamlessly with various devices and formats, but compatibility issues can arise with certain cables, devices, or formats. This can lead to audio or video not being transmitted correctly, resulting in poor performance or a complete lack of functionality.
  • Overheating: High performance and extensive usage can lead to overheating in smart AV receivers. If the device does not have adequate ventilation or is placed in a confined space, it may shut down automatically or show performance degradation to prevent damage.
  • User Interface Confusion: The user interface of smart AV receivers can sometimes be complex, especially for users unfamiliar with technology. This can result in difficulties navigating settings, accessing features, or troubleshooting problems, leading to frustration and underutilization of the device’s capabilities.

What are the Best Practices for Setting Up a Smart AV Receiver?

When setting up a smart AV receiver, following best practices ensures optimal performance and user experience.

  • Proper Placement: Place the AV receiver in a well-ventilated area, ideally in an entertainment center or shelf that allows for airflow. Avoid enclosing it in tight spaces, as this can lead to overheating and affect performance.
  • Connection Quality: Use high-quality cables and connectors for all inputs and outputs, including HDMI, speaker wires, and Ethernet. This helps minimize signal degradation and ensures the best audio and video quality.
  • Network Configuration: Connect your smart AV receiver to a stable Wi-Fi network or use Ethernet for a more reliable connection. Proper network setup is crucial for streaming services and smart home integration to function seamlessly.
  • Speaker Calibration: Utilize the built-in calibration tools of the AV receiver to optimize speaker placement and sound settings. This process adjusts audio output based on the room’s acoustics, enhancing the overall listening experience.
  • Firmware Updates: Regularly check for and install firmware updates for your AV receiver. Manufacturers often release updates to improve performance, fix bugs, and add new features, ensuring your device stays current.
  • Input Management: Organize and label all input connections clearly to streamline switching between devices. This practice simplifies operation and enhances the user experience when using various sources like gaming consoles, streaming devices, or Blu-ray players.
  • Smart Home Integration: If applicable, integrate your AV receiver with smart home systems and voice assistants. This allows for convenient control and automation, such as turning on the receiver with voice commands or managing it through a smartphone app.
